A man was stabbed to death by unidentified persons in the Batamaloo area of Srinagar on Tuesday, reports said. Some unknown persons attacked a man identified as Ajaz Ahmad Bhat, a resident of Momin-Abad at Bypass-Batmaloo near Dar Iron Traders in Srinagar on Tuesday evening, injuring him critically, said a report. He was shifted to SKIMS Bemina where doctors declared him dead on arrival. Principal SKIMS Bemina, Dr. Irfan told news agency KDC that the man was brought dead to the hospital. India will host the Shanghai Cooperation Organisation (SCO) Summit virtually on July 4, with people familiar with the matter saying the decision was the outcome of consultations over the past few days. The external affairs ministry announced on Tuesday that the 22nd summit of the SCO council of heads of state will be held in the “virtual format” and chaired by Prime Minister Narendra Modi. Four persons were killed and another injured after their car plunged into a deep gorge in Jammu and Kashmir’s Doda district late on Monday, police said. Doda senior superintendent of police (SSP) Abdul Qayoom said, “This evening an accident took place on Batote-Doda national highway near Ragi Nallah (a rivulet) in which a private Swift Desire car rolled 200 metres down into the Nallah. A civilian, hailing from Udhampur district, was shot dead on Monday evening at Ashajipora area of South Kashmir’s Anantnag. Police in a tweet informed that a civilian identified as Deepu from Udhampur, working at a private circus mela at Amusement Park near Janglaat Mandi in Anantnag, was fired upon by the militants. The Delhi high court on Monday sought a response from separatist leader and chief of Jammu and Kashmir Liberation Front (JKLF) Yasin Malik, who was awarded a life term by a trial court, on a plea by the National Investigation Agency (NIA) seeking the death penalty against him in a terror funding case. A bench of justices Siddharth Mridul and Talwant Singh also issued the production warrant for Malik to appear before the court on the next date of hearing on August 9. A day after the National Investigation Agency (NIA) sought the death penalty for Yasin Malik, former Jammu and Kashmir Chief Minister Mehbooba Mufti said his case must be reviewed and reconsidered, reported Press Trust of India. Mufti said that Jammu and Kashmir Liberation Front (JKLF) chief Yasin Malik’s case must be reviewed and reconsidered as in a democracy like India even the assassins of a prime minister were pardoned. The Hurriyat Conference led by Mirwaiz Umar Farooq on Sunday called the National Investigation Agency (NIA)’s plea seeking death penalty for separatist leader Yasin Malik as “deeply disturbing” while Apni Party leader Altaf Bukhari termed the agency’s approach “hasty”. On Friday, the NIA approached the Delhi high court seeking death penalty for separatist leader and chief of the Jammu and Kashmir Liberation Front (JKLF) Yasin Malik, who was awarded life term by a trial court in a terror funding case. Delhi University’s Academic Council (AC) on Friday cleared a number of syllabi changes, including the scrapping of poet Mohd Iqbal from the BA political science syllabus, officials aware of the matter said. They added that the council also approved proposals to set up new centres for Partition Studies, Hindu Studies and Tribal Studies. Iqbal who wrote the popular song “Sare jahan se acha Hindustan hamara” is one of the most prominent Urdu and Persian poets of the Indian subcontinent.
